Recently, the Toronto Maple Leafs, Ottawa Senators, Detroit Red Wings and Minnesota Wild ventures to Stockholm, Sweden for the National Hockey League's Global series. Many fans were wondering how the league chose who would play as the home and away teams and why Toronto got two away games.
According to Elliotte Friedman of Sportsnet, the NHL is forced to cut a check to a team who loses a home game. Which makes it a lot easier to pay a team like Ottawa instead of Toronto.
Friedman says that when it comes to the global series the league is basically robbing, and has to pay for a home games gate.
You'll notice that Ottawa had 2 Home games while Toronto had 2 away games simply because the NHL found it easier to cut a check with Ottawa #GoSensGo
The Leafs are one of the most valuable franchises in sport, so of course it would be easier to cut a deal with Ottawa. This also explains why the league chose to not give the Leafs a home game. Unlike Toronto, Ottawa games don't always sell out and the lower ticket values make that check a much easier one to write.
